Source Durable Parts and Filters with Clear Specs

Material choices can make or break comfort in a hot-dry climate. We match insulation R-values, foil tapes, putty sealants, and UV-resistant wraps to attic temps that can top 140°F by noon. HVAC Filters get sized to airflow and dust load, not just price; a high MERV without fan headroom chokes circulation. We also validate motor and control compatibility before ordering. In a small office suite, we might pair a variable-speed air handler with balanced returns to tame afternoon spikes.



Fancy add-ons can’t fix poor fit. We weigh static pressure, coil surface area, and condensate routing so water won’t back up during monsoon surges. Seal leaks before you think about bigger equipment. A modest filter rack upgrade plus rigid elbows can drop noise and lift airflow without touching equipment. Little adjustments compound into major comfort.

Stop Hot Spots Early with Targeted Checks

Quality isn’t a sticker; it’s a trail of numbers you can see. We run pre- and post-leak tests, temperature checks, and static reads to prove gains rather than promise them. HVAC When numbers drift, we correct root issues, not cosmetics. In one bungalow, sealing a return plenum gap erased a bedroom heat pocket within hours.



Risk workbooks guide calls under pressure. Rain predicted? We secure attic openings, tarp materials, and shift cuts indoors. Extra debris? We tighten barriers and change filters sooner. Electrical surprises get flagged, locked out, and escalated to a licensed pro before anyone proceeds. Strong controls make the gains stick.
